In this episode of The Resilience Mentality, Emily Morrison and Susan McDonald discuss resiliency within a family unit. Parenting can be hard, and it doesn’t come with a manual, but that doesn’t mean you have to do it alone. Triple P is a great resource for parents to learn skills that allow parenting to be enjoyable again.
